无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站广告联系 微信:wuyouceo QQ:184822951
楼主: captain_g

[分享] 完全自制自用的WIN7PE,注入过USB3.0/3.1驱动、NVMe驱动、原生网络支持

    [复制链接]
 楼主| 发表于 2018-11-23 16:59:38 | 显示全部楼层
njenje 发表于 2018-11-23 16:08
请提供阿弥陀佛(Win7REx64_by_TXM.iso  http://bbs.wuyou.net/forum.php?mod=viewthread&tid=256836)下载 ...

不好意思,没有收藏过。

前次有网友提到阿弥陀佛的7PE,讲到如何提取驱动的问题,他应该有收藏。
回复

使用道具 举报

发表于 2018-11-23 20:40:21 | 显示全部楼层
保留WIN7PE的主题、看图Windows Photo Viewer,比较好。
回复

使用道具 举报

 楼主| 发表于 2018-11-23 20:46:26 | 显示全部楼层
njenje 发表于 2018-11-23 20:40
保留WIN7PE的主题、看图Windows Photo Viewer,比较好。

第6页的网友 tyc600 他应该有 阿弥陀佛的 7PE。

我自己弄的这个7PE,不想再折腾了,年底了有点小忙。
回复

使用道具 举报

发表于 2018-11-23 21:52:06 | 显示全部楼层
楼主能否把你的7,8,9,10项的文件打包分享一下,我用你的pe试了可以识别我的ssd,但是我装的win7暂时识别不了。我想用你的文件注入win7中。
回复

使用道具 举报

发表于 2018-11-24 00:57:39 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-11-24 12:05:19 | 显示全部楼层
本帖最后由 captain_g 于 2018-11-24 12:10 编辑
xintiandi 发表于 2018-11-23 21:52
楼主能否把你的7,8,9,10项的文件打包分享一下,我用你的pe试了可以识别我的ssd,但是我装的win7暂时识别 ...


功能补丁在公司电脑里,只能周一打包放到网盘里。

其他驱动,可以直接用DISM++提取的(不解开就用DISM++挂载后提取,解开的就先添加路径)。
回复

使用道具 举报

 楼主| 发表于 2018-11-24 12:07:41 | 显示全部楼层
KevinK 发表于 2018-11-24 00:57
原来都是高手再用,请问一下楼主,怎么把您的文件整合成一个WIN7的ISO?  能否提供一个成品的ISO,或者写个 ...

网盘里有打包工具的,只要把BOOT.WIM放在相应位置,执行相应的批处理即可。
回复

使用道具 举报

发表于 2018-11-24 14:35:45 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-11-24 15:47:46 | 显示全部楼层
本帖最后由 captain_g 于 2018-11-24 15:57 编辑
KevinK 发表于 2018-11-24 14:35
谢谢大神的回复,但是小白还是不太懂,求教一下:
1.BU型光盘镜像指的是什么?还有B型呢?前3项都是不可 ...


BU型指生成的ISO支持BIOS或UEFI两种类型的启动;

32位WIN7不支持UEFI启动,所以打包成的ISO只能BIOS启动;

G4D型系指光盘启动文件用的是G4D提供的,打包成的ISO只能BIOS启动;

以上只打包一个BOOT.WIM;

至于合集打包,不记得当初是怎么弄的了,应该BIOS和UEFI都支持的,文件怎么放进去,用什么名称,里面有说明,可以打开看看BCD里是怎么说的,自己能改就按自己要去编辑改动。

UEFI启动文件在光盘启动文件中,在打包成的ISO中是看不见的,32位或64位UEFI自动识别。只要不刻盘,随便打包,打包后要启动测试器或虚拟机试试看。

如果不清楚,只按说明放文件进去,执行批处理即可,其他都不要动。

回头我有功夫再看看。
回复

使用道具 举报

 楼主| 发表于 2018-11-24 16:04:42 | 显示全部楼层
KevinK 发表于 2018-11-24 14:35
谢谢大神的回复,但是小白还是不太懂,求教一下:
1.BU型光盘镜像指的是什么?还有B型呢?前3项都是不可 ...

关于WIN7PE,因WIN7原生是不支持NVME的,所以做了两种,一种是含NVME补丁及驱动的,另一种是不含的。主要是怕带NVME的WIN7PE兼容性不佳,在启动过程中不能识别NVME SSD而卡死;不带NVME的,原则上应该能进系统,只是不识别NVME SSD而已,因为用NVME SSD的电脑,大多系统中还有一块HDD盘;

WIN7老矣,除非必须,尤其是有NVME SSD的,还是用10PE吧。
回复

使用道具 举报

发表于 2018-11-24 16:11:03 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2018-11-24 16:20:38 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-11-24 16:26:15 | 显示全部楼层
KevinK 发表于 2018-11-24 16:20
好的,谢谢了,这两天看到这个帖子,想试试,然后就在本论坛搜了一下,找到您的帖子,因为有一台电脑,家 ...

不好意思,那个是自己用的,放在网盘里了,没想到有人要啊。

所有WIM文件最终要改成BOOT.WIM,放在SOURCES文件夹中;

看那些批处理,前面有个数字,要打成什么样的,就看那个文件夹最后是ISO?,放BOOT.WIM到里面的SOURCES文件夹中就行了。最终文件目录结构像微软的。
回复

使用道具 举报

发表于 2018-11-24 16:32:23 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-11-24 16:43:54 | 显示全部楼层
本帖最后由 captain_g 于 2018-11-24 16:47 编辑
KevinK 发表于 2018-11-24 16:32
“WIM文件最终要改成BOOT.WIM,放在SOURCES文件夹中”,原来是这样,谢谢您回复,明白了


还有那个合集打包的,刚看了一下,支持UEFI和BIOS双启动型;

但不自动判断是64位还是32位,主要是考虑“安全启动”限制,用了微软原版的文件;

MAKE-ISO文件夹中有两个文本文件,当初自己备注的,不看也罢,容易引起误解,可删除!

如果不考虑ISO的体积大小限制,都可以往里面放,也可以定制的,里面有两个BCD,一个是boot\bcd,另一个是efi\microsoft\boot\bcd,打开、会改就简单了(用论坛里的BOOTICE)。

2003或XP的PE,直接ISO文件放进去,用里面示例的文件名!
回复

使用道具 举报

发表于 2018-11-24 17:55:33 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-11-24 20:13:29 | 显示全部楼层
本帖最后由 captain_g 于 2018-11-24 20:28 编辑
KevinK 发表于 2018-11-24 17:55
谢谢,刚又WINPE-ISO打包和WINPE-ISO合集打包工具各试了一次,无NVME的,无论32还是64在纯UEFI下无法启动 ...


脚本只是打包ISO的,有没有测试ISO能不能启动?论坛里有“Qemu启动测试器”可以用来测试。

用ULTRAISO将ISO写入U盘有可能是不行的。BIOS启动,U盘的MBR/PBR要配BOOTMGR,即使如此U盘根目录下的BOOTMGR也不一定就去找U盘上的文件,它有可能先去找硬盘上的文件。

如果是U盘UEFI启,不存在MBR/PRB的概念,U盘文件系统必须是FAT32,不需要用UI写,直接把所有文件拷贝过去即可,但要保持目录结构,即BOOT、EFI、SOURCES必须在根目录下。

实机测试UEFI启动,一台机器不可能既是32位的又是64位的,早期的WIN平板尤其是WIN8平板多是32位的UEFI,最近的平板、笔电、台式机、二合一应该都是64位的UEFI。

还有32位WIN7PE,不支持UEFI,肯定起不来;但64位WIN7PE,在纯UEFI平台下也不一定起得来,通常需要主板开启兼容模块(CSM)。

正常情况下,只要CPU是64位的,BIOS启动是不分32位还是64位的,即两种都应能起来。只有UEFI启动才分32位或64位。
回复

使用道具 举报

发表于 2018-11-24 20:35:31 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2018-11-24 20:42:29 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2018-11-25 14:25:38 | 显示全部楼层
captain_g 发表于 2018-11-24 12:05
功能补丁在公司电脑里,只能周一打包放到网盘里。

其他驱动,可以直接用DISM++提取的(不解开就用DI ...

好的,感谢分享。
回复

使用道具 举报

 楼主| 发表于 2018-11-26 09:11:21 | 显示全部楼层
xintiandi 发表于 2018-11-25 14:25
好的,感谢分享。

东西已经上传到网盘中了,文件名:4WIN7.7z
回复

使用道具 举报

发表于 2018-11-26 10:56:29 | 显示全部楼层
captain_g 发表于 2018-11-26 09:11
东西已经上传到网盘中了,文件名:4WIN7.7z

非常感谢。
回复

使用道具 举报

发表于 2018-11-27 14:48:57 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

发表于 2018-11-27 15:18:35 | 显示全部楼层
good work
回复

使用道具 举报

 楼主| 发表于 2018-11-27 16:27:39 | 显示全部楼层
本帖最后由 captain_g 于 2018-11-27 16:32 编辑
KevinK 发表于 2018-11-27 14:48
大神请教一个问题,看到您都用脚本语言把文件封装成功ISO格式的文件,我经常把可引导的ISO解压后,再用ultr ...


如果用UI处理UEFI/BIOS双启动类型的ISO,需要用比较新版本的UI,好像最起码要9.6以上。

你的问题:已经把原来的ISO解开放在硬盘上的文件夹中了,做过内容修改,然后又用UI打包成一个新的ISO,这个新的ISO不可启动,对吧?

解决方法:

一、直接双击或用右键菜单通过UI打开ISO文件,按需删除、替换、增添文件进去,然后保存或另存为新的ISO,一般情况下原来可启的,处理后仍然可以启动。注

意是“打开”,不是“解开”或“解压”后放到硬盘中的文件夹中!

二、一定要弄到硬盘文件夹中然后再封包成ISO

2.1 通过UI打开原ISO文件,通过UI的菜单【启动】、【保存引导文件...】,先把光盘引导文件提取出来,起个文件名,放好;

2.2 通过UI打开新的不可启的ISO文件,通过UI的菜单【启动】、【加载引导文件...】,找到前一步提取出来的文件,弄进去,然后保存即可。

!当然,比如WIN系统盘,举例,如果你把根目录下的那个BOOTMGR或其他关联的什么文件给删掉了,即使ISO有“引导文件”或显示为“可启动”,也是起不来的!

当用UI打开一个ISO,可以在软件的左上方看到光盘是否“可启动”,即使是可启动的光盘,其引导文件在资源管理器中是看不见的,这个看不见不是隐藏不隐藏的问题。

ISO的引导文件可大可小,大的可能有几百M,有的ISO大小7-8百M,可里面文件明明只有区区几十M,就是它的引导区放了大体积的东东。
回复

使用道具 举报

发表于 2018-11-27 22:52:12 | 显示全部楼层
提示: 作者被禁止或删除 内容自动屏蔽
回复

使用道具 举报

 楼主| 发表于 2018-12-4 11:55:54 | 显示全部楼层
njenje 发表于 2018-11-23 20:40
保留WIN7PE的主题、看图Windows Photo Viewer,比较好。

这两天有点空,按照你的意思草草整了一下,添加了WIN7主题,看图也改成了PV;

只关联了BMP/PNG/JPG/TIF/ICO/GIF最常用的几种;

已传到网盘中,两个ISO文件;
回复

使用道具 举报

 楼主| 发表于 2018-12-17 16:50:33 | 显示全部楼层
又花了一些时间,完善了一下。
1.png
回复

使用道具 举报

发表于 2018-12-17 20:42:31 | 显示全部楼层
维护用感觉版本高的好一点!7有好多功能都没有呀!
回复

使用道具 举报

发表于 2019-1-1 08:17:26 | 显示全部楼层
感谢分享
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-3-28 18:24

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表